Three Tracks from Brian Wilson Double CD Live at the Roxy Theatre Streamed to Launch Official Brianwilson.com Web Site
Brian Wilson Live at the Roxy Theatre Double CD Available Only Online
May 30, 2000 Brian Wilson, founding member of the Beach Boys and co-creator of the classic "California sound," will launch his official Web site http://www.brianwilson.com, June 1, 2000. Music from Wilson's new double CD, Live at the Roxy Theatre, will be streamed on the site. The songs available for listening on the Web include Brian's version of the Barenaked Ladies' smash "Brian Wilson," a new Brian Wilson composition, "The First Time," and an updated rendition of the classic "Add Some Music to
Your Day."
In addition to the music, http://www.brianwilson.com will feature rare photos, a fan bulletin board with the first message from Brian himself, video prepared exclusively for the site, and current dates for Brian's eagerly anticipated summer tour of the United States. The tour, selected by the Chicago Tribune as the number one concert of the summer, will feature complete performances of the platinum-certified "Pet Sounds" with local symphony orchestras.
Wilson's new double CD, Live at the Roxy Theatre, which includes classic tracks, new songs, and acoustic versions of some of his favorites selected from his long group and solo career is currently available only on the Web.
